Meet Septy.

Artisan Verrier

Septy has been working as a glassblower since the early 2000s. After three years of training at the Centre Européen de Recherche et de Formation aux Arts Verriers, he graduated as a master glassmaker. He then spent five years travelling around Europe as a journeyman glassmaker, gaining experience and meeting new people.

He is now based at the Abbaye du Rouge-Cloître in Brussels, where he works with flame-worked glass. He mainly makes beads, jewellery and spun glass sculptures. He has developed precise skills in glass lacemaking, a technique that requires rigour and patience. His creations deal with themes related to beliefs, be they religious, political or philosophical.

Recognised in his field, he has presented his work in a number of exhibitions, including the Musée des Beaux-Arts in Nancy. During the demonstrations, workshops and events he leads, he takes the time to explain the steps involved in working with glass, the techniques he uses and the challenges of his profession.

For him, this craft is also a way to concentrate, to escape from everyday life and to pass on technical know-how in a clear and educational way.
